Transaction 32f48c66ea106abcf3075ae324efa9c03976de811764cb2c71312a830917ed09

1 Input
2 Outputs
  • 32f48c66ea106abcf3075ae324efa9c03976de811764cb2c71312a830917ed09:0
  • value  40000000
    address  3La6QgSGVx4UAUxWSDTtWUV5rZrXTuQ9iN
  • 32f48c66ea106abcf3075ae324efa9c03976de811764cb2c71312a830917ed09:1
  • value  302720433
    address  35kkmKcm5jLFoQr82xvxbKTerSNy6cK8Xj